Nitto NT05 Tread life????
 
Looking to put some Nitto NT05'S on. I drive street with raging outburst of extreme use :eekdance:. What would the tread life be with a full set of Nitto NT05's?

import111 09-09-2009 08:42 PM

Not long at all. They only start at 7/32 of tread, instead of the normal 9/32 or 10/32. They are also very sticky which means the tread will where away quickly.

I had the same tires which I just sold on this thread. Anyway, the tires only had about 7500 miles. Look at the pics in the thread. Tread is pretty low. About 25% remaining. Remember only 7500 miles on them. I don't drive VERY aggressively so the pics should give you insight on what to expect. Good luck!
